Interviews (Q&As)
Engage and captivate your patient base by sharing insightful interviews on your practice blog. This versatile blog format allows you to interview not only yourself but also your staff and industry experts. By providing unique content that can’t be found elsewhere, you’ll draw patients to your blog, building trust and fostering patient loyalty.
How-tos / Tutorials
As a doctor, you possess a wealth of knowledge that can benefit your patients. Share your expertise through tutorial videos, demonstrating practical tips and techniques that can truly make a difference in their lives. For instance, a dentist can create a video showcasing the proper way to floss, providing valuable lessons that patients can share with their loved ones.
Personal Stories / Patient Case Studies
Patients often feel isolated when facing health issues. Sharing personal stories or patient case studies can offer reassurance and inspire hope. By highlighting how you have successfully treated a specific condition or helped a patient overcome a particular health challenge, you establish yourself as an experienced and empathetic healthcare provider.
News Commentary
When a health issue impacting your patient base makes headlines, your audience wants to hear your expert opinion. Writing blog posts with news commentary not only boosts your search rankings but also showcases your specialized knowledge. Keep in mind that while expressing passionate opinions, it’s essential to communicate in a way that resonates with your patients, using language they understand.
Reviews / Comparisons
Patients value your opinion and trust your recommendations. Sharing reviews or comparing different healthcare products or services adds value to your blog. By providing insightful insights and helping patients make informed decisions, you become a trusted source for their healthcare needs.
Video Blogs
Video content is in high demand, with people increasingly turning to explainer videos to learn about products and services. Incorporating video blogs into your healthcare marketing strategy is an excellent way to engage and inform your audience. By utilizing this preferred format, you can effectively market your products and services and meet the expectations of modern consumers.
FAQs
Turn frequently asked questions into informative blog posts that address common concerns and queries. By dedicating a blog post (or several) to FAQs, you not only save time by providing ready answers but also establish yourself as a reliable source of information. Existing patients will appreciate the convenience, and prospective patients searching online for specific topics will discover your valuable insights.
